Uipath chrome print dialog

I am building a robot to print pdf from chrome web page.
While using send hot key ctrl+P, it keeps opening windows print dialog instead of chrome’s. I have already put the “Sendhotkey” activity inside the browser scope.

Using right click and select print does not work for me either. It will show chrome extension error. But I already follow all the materials from uipath and try to fix the extension error, and all of them did not work. Hope someone can help on this! Thank you!
